🧭 1. Smart Space Planning: Every Inch Counts
The first step to designing a small space is strategic planning. Every inch should serve a purpose — or two.
Key principles of 2025 space planning:
- Define zones (living, dining, working) even in open layouts.
- Choose multi-functional furniture.
- Prioritize vertical storage to free floor area.
- Keep circulation spaces clear.
💡 Pro Tip: Use visual separators like rugs, ceiling beams, or lighting patterns instead of walls.

🌈 3. Light & Color to Expand Visual Space
Color and lighting can dramatically change how spacious a room feels.
Trends for 2025:
- Soft neutrals — off-whites, creams, light greys.
- Pastel accents like mint, blush, and sky blue.
- Glossy finishes and mirrors that reflect light.
- Layered lighting — ambient, task, and accent lights.
💡 Pro Tip: Paint ceilings a shade lighter than walls to visually lift the height of the room.

🌿 5. Vertical Storage & Floating Furniture
When floor space is limited, go upward. 2025 interiors utilize vertical storage and floating designs to declutter and open up the room.
Design strategies:
- Wall-mounted shelves and hanging racks.
- Floating TV units and vanities.
- Floor-to-ceiling cabinets with integrated lighting.
- Loft beds or mezzanine storage zones.
💡 Pro Tip: Keep lower half of the room light and airy; let upper areas hold storage.

🪴 6. Mirrors & Glass for Spacious Illusion
A timeless trick that’s getting smarter in 2025 — mirrors and glass help multiply visual space and natural light.
Creative uses:
- Mirror-backed shelves.
- Glass partitions between bedroom and living.
- Mirrored wardrobe doors.
- Reflective metallic accents in décor.
💡 Pro Tip: Place mirrors opposite windows to double the daylight effect.

🛋️ 13. Bathroom Space Optimization
Even the tiniest bathrooms can feel luxurious with smart planning.
Design hacks:
- Floating vanities and wall-hung toilets.
- Glass shower partitions to keep the space open.
- Built-in shelves inside walls.
- Vertical mirrors for height illusion.
💡 Pro Tip: Choose large tiles and minimal grout lines to make bathrooms appear bigger.
